Mughlai Biryani: Mughlai Biryani is a popular dish in Agra, and it is made with long-grained rice, spices, and meat (usually chicken or mutton). It is a flavorful and aromatic dish that is a must-try when you’re in Agra.

Kebabs: Agra is famous for its kebabs, and you can find a variety of them here. Some of the popular kebabs include Seekh Kebab, Boti Kebab, and Reshmi Kebab.

Mughlai Chicken: Mughlai Chicken is a popular dish in Agra, and it is made with chicken cooked in a rich gravy made with cream, nuts, and spices.

Bedai and Jalebi: Bedai and Jalebi is a popular breakfast dish in Agra. Bedai is a deep-fried bread made with flour and stuffed with lentil paste, and Jalebi is a sweet made with flour and sugar syrup.

Dalmoth: Dalmoth is a popular snack in Agra, and it is made with fried lentils, nuts, and spices. It is a crunchy and flavorful snack that is perfect with a cup of tea.

Petha: Petha is a sweet made from white pumpkin and is a specialty of Agra. It comes in various flavors such as plain, saffron, and chocolate.
